VASA protein is a member of the DEAD(Asp-Glu-Alu-Asp) box family of ATP-dependent RNA helicases and initially found as a component of germ plasm in Drosophila. vasa gene is specifically expressed in germ-line cells of many metazoans. At present, vasa gene has been extensively used as a specific molecular marker of germ-line cells and played an important role in the research of gametogenesis and reproductive regulation. Urechis unicinctus, classified to Echiuroidea, is a familiar species of echiuran along the coast of Yellow and Bohai in China. In the present study, homolog cloning strategy and SMART RACE technique were used to isolate and clone the vasa gene of U. unicinctus, and semi-quantitative RT-PCR was conducted to analyze the spatial and temporal expression of vasa mRNA. The results are expected to provide some basic knowledge for further investigation of ontogenesis, differentiation of germ cells and reproduction regulation in U. unicinctus.The full length vasa cDNA sequence of 4,080 bp comprised an open reading frame (ORF) of 2,322 bp encoding a polypeptide of 773 amino acids, a 5'untranslated region (UTR) of 322 bp and a 3'UTR of 1,436 bp. The deduced amino-acid sequence showed a great similarity to VASA homologues in mammal, fish, amphibian, insect and other invertebrate. Besides eight conserved motifs of all DEAD-box family proteins were observed, the U. unicinctus VASA protein shared multiple arginine-glycine-arginine (RGG) repeats and a glycine(G)-rich in the NH2-terminal portion with other VASA-related proteins. Furthermore, phylogenetic analysis showed the deduced amino acids sequence was classified to VASA-related proteins, and was designated as UuVASA.
